Two mutations affecting conserved residues in the Met receptor operate via different mechanisms.
Oncogene - 2 Mar 2000
Maritano D, Accornero P, Bonifaci N, Ponzetto C
Abstract excerpt
We have investigated the mechanism by which two oncogenic mutations (M1268T and D1246H/N; Amino-acids are numbered according to Schmidt et al., 1999) affecting conserved residues in the catalytic domain of the Met receptor, activate its transforming potential. Both mutations were previously found in tumorigenic forms of the Ret and Kit receptors, respectively. The mutated residues are located either in the P+1...
